Lufkin is a perfect 5-0 against Texas since April of 2015 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Friday. The Panthers will head out on the road to face off against the Tigers at 5:00 p.m. Lufkin's pitching crew has only allowed 3.2 runs per game this season, so Texas' hitters will have their work cut out for them.
Lufkin is probably headed into the game with a chip on their shoulder considering Hallsville just ended the team's 15-game winning streak on Tuesday. They fell 3-0 to the Bobcats. The matchup marked the first time this year in which the Panthers were not able to get on the board.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Texas). They were the clear victors by a 21-2 margin over Jacksonville on Tuesday. The result was nothing new for the Tigers, who have now won 12 contests by six runs or more so far this season.
Texas is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six games. That's provided a nice bump to their 18-7-1 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.8 runs on average over those games. As for Lufkin, their defeat was their first in the district, dropping their district record down to 12-1 and their overall record down to 21-4.
Lufkin beat Texas 5-2 when the teams last played back in March.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Panthers since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
